使用方法 经验 方法mysql

Javascript 加密解密方法

本文链接 Javascript 和 我之前发的 python加密 以及 go加密 解密不一样 不需要导那么多的库 只需要安装几个库 其中需要了解最多的 crypto-js 具体就不多介绍了直接上官网 https://www.npmjs.com/package/crypto-js 准备工作 安装 在终 ......
加密解密 Javascript 方法

使用ChatGPT控制机器人

当我还在跟 ChatGPT 吹牛尬聊时,有人已经在拿它操控机器人了。 不是别人,正是 OpenAI 的金主爸爸、不久前刚拿 ChatGPT“重新发明搜索引擎”的微软。 到目前为止,开发者调教机器人不仅技术门槛高,还道阻且长: 工程师需要在工作流程回路中,不断手写新代码和规范来纠正机器人行为;另外,操 ......
机器人 机器 ChatGPT

MySQL事务还没提交,Canal就能读到消息了?

##【问题描述】 开发有天碰到一个很奇怪的问题,他的场景是这样子的: 通过Canal来订阅MySQL的binlog, 当捕获到有数据变化时,回到数据库,反查该数据的明细,然后做进一步处理。 有一次,他碰到一个诡异的现象: 1. Canal收到消息,有一条主键id=31019319的数据插入 2. 1 ......
事务 消息 MySQL Canal

利用java中的反射机制,动态的执行方法并根据表字段中配置的属性名称动态获取对应的导入的属性值。

private void getPointTxNameAndCall(ConcreteEquipmentInfo info, ConcreteMonitorRealTime realTime,MonitoringRecordImportVO importVO) throws Exception { ......
属性 动态 字段 机制 名称

vue2中使用TinyMCE

背景 整理使用到的tinymce的富文本,http://tinymce.ax-z.cn/,这个是大佬写的中文文档,如果自己有兴趣的话,可以去看看英文文档。 Tinymce 由于项目原因,使用的是vue2.x版本,所以我选择使用的是"@tinymce/tinymce-vue": "^3.0.1"和"t ......
TinyMCE vue2 vue

使用docker-compose安装启动单机redis

下载redis的配置文件 下载地址 我这里是下载的版本7的config 创建文件目录 cd / sudo mkdir /docker-compose/redis && cd /docker-compose/redis sudo mkdir data && touch redis.conf && to ......
docker-compose 单机 compose docker redis

【Android逆向】定位native函数在哪个so中方法

1. 在逆向过程中经常需要定位方法在哪个so中,而app加载的so很多,比如 那么如何快速定位方法在哪里呢 2. 比如如下案例,首先看日志 03-28 11:01:56.457 14566 14566 D KM-NATIVE: JNI_OnLoad 03-28 11:01:56.457 14566 ......
函数 Android 方法 native

mysql binlog 几种日志格式的区别?

在MySQL中,二进制日志(binlog)是用于记录数据库操作的一种日志文件,主要用于主从复制、恢复数据等操作。MySQL提供了三种不同的二进制日志格式,分别是 Statement、Row 和 Mixed。它们之间的区别如下: Statement格式:该格式记录SQL语句的原始文本。这意味着在从主库 ......
格式 binlog mysql 日志

Power BI如何连接MySQL数据库

既然写了如何卸载MySQL connector net(相关文章见如何解决MySQL Connector NET xxxx无法卸载的问题(win10)),那就顺便再写一篇Power BI(以下简称PBI)如何连接MySQL数据库吧 在系统没有安装MySQL connector net之前,如果在PB ......
数据库 数据 Power MySQL

【面试专栏】Java5 - Future,基本使用

1. 简介 在使用多线程开发中,不论是继承Thread类还是实现Runnable接口方式,都无法非常方便的获取异步任务执行的结果。在JDK1.5提供了和Runnable类似但多了返回值的Callable接口,通过Future接口实现类和Callable接口方式,可以非常灵活的进行多线程操作,例如:获 ......
专栏 Future Java5 Java

使用Map和循环,优化对象扩展语法操作

在pnpm的一次提交中,优化了针对对象扩展语法的操作...{}。通过如下代码: const allDeps = { ...projectSnapshot.devDependencies, ...projectSnapshot.dependencies, ...projectSnapshot.opti ......
语法 对象 Map

使用docker-compose安装启动mysql

首先安装docker-compose 以ubuntu举例 sudo apt install docker-compose 1.创建文件夹 cd / sudo mkdir docker-compose && cd docker-compose sudo mkdir mysql && cd mysql ......
docker-compose compose docker mysql

[linux, windows]pyenv, virtualenv, virtualenvwrapper使用安装

一.Linux环境 1.下载github pyenv手动安装,设置环境变量 # pyenv,修改.bashrc或者.bash_profile export PYENV_ROOT="$PYTHON_LIBRARY/pyenv-installer/pyenv" export PATH=$PYENV_RO ......

.NetCore 使用 RabbitMQ (交换机/队列/消息持久化+mq高级特性+死信队列+延迟队列)

一、安装mq 2、创建公共项目Commons用于提供者和消费者引用,nuget安装 RabbitMQ.Client,添加一个帮助类: public class RabbitMQHelper { //连接mq public static IConnection GetMQConnection() { ......
队列 死信 交换机 RabbitMQ 特性

java方法-数组(定义,声明创建)

数组概述 数组的定义 数组是相同类型数据的有序集合 数组描述的是相同类型的若干个数据,按照一定的先后次序排列组合而成 其中,每一个数据称作一个数组元素,每个数组元素可以通过一个数组下标来访问它们 数组声明创建 首先必须声明数组变量,才能在程序中使用数组。下面是声明变量的语法: dataType[] ......
数组 方法 java

MYsql数据库的概述(韩顺平)

Mysql的安装 命令行连接到MySql Mysql是一个服务 在连接mysql之前必须保证mysql是运行的状态 连接mysql中 -u root 表示的是用户名 连接mysql的注意事项 Navicat的安装和使用 这个页面其实和我们在黑框中中的连接指令的意思是一样的 本机写成127.0.0.1 ......
数据库 数据 MYsql

qs.stringify()、qs.parse()的使用

一、qs是什么? qs是一个npm仓库所管理的包,可通过npm install qs命令进行安装(axios 自带qs , // import qs from 'qs') import qs from "qs"; 二、基本用法 2.1、qs.stringify() 将对象序列化成URL的形式,以&进 ......
stringify parse qs

flutter系列之:在flutter中使用媒体播放器

简介 现在的app功能越来越强大,除了基本的图文之外,还需要各种各样的其他的功能,比如视频,和直播。 直播可能会比较复杂,因为涉及到了拉流和推流,需要服务器端的支持,但是视频播放就比较简单了,那么如何在flutter中使用媒体播放器呢? 一起来看看吧。 使用前的准备工作 flutter本身是不支持媒 ......
flutter 播放器 媒体

如何解决MySQL Connector NET xxxx无法卸载的问题(win10)

使用Power BI(以下简称PBI)的小伙伴想必都知道,想要在PBI连接MySQL数据库,必须安装MySQL connector net,我之前安装过MySQL connector net 6.9.3,PBI是可以正常连接MySQL的,最近更新了PBI,然后发现无法连接MySQL数据库了,并且想重 ......
Connector 问题 MySQL xxxx NET

FreeSwitch的基本了解和简单使用

一、安装FreeSwitch系统 FreeSwitch本身是跨平台的,作为学习,此处使用windows安装方式,点击下载windows版本的安装包,进行傻瓜式安装,安装后目录结构如下: 其中各文件夹和文件的说明如下: cert 证书密钥目录 conf 配置文件目录 db 默认的FreeSwitch数 ......
FreeSwitch

webpack的基本使用二

新建空白文件夹 作为项目文件的更目录,然后运行 npm init -y 2.在项目根目录中新建src源代码目录 3.在src目录下新建index.html和index.js脚本文件 4.我们在html页面里面初始化页面的基本结构 5.运行npm install jQuery -S 安装jQuery ......
webpack

Vue子组件向父组件传值(this.$emit()方法)

子组件使用this.$emit()向父组件传值 首先必须在父组件中引用子组件,然后实现传值 第一步在父组件中引入子组件 import UnitByPurchaseAddOrUpdate from '@views/modules/matter/UnitByPurchaseAddOrUpdate' 声明 ......
组件 方法 this emit Vue

浩辰CAD看图王中如何实现数字递增?CAD文字递增使用攻略!

在浩辰CAD中复制文字时,可以通过调用CAD文字递增命令来选择数字或字母并使其按照一定的规律进行复制,此命令在创建递增的编号或序号时非常方便。那么,在手机中编辑图纸时,如何才能使CAD文字自动递增呢?下面一起来看看浩辰CAD看图王APP中是如何快速完成数字/字母递增的标注的吧! CAD文字递增步骤: ......
CAD 文字 数字 攻略

第四篇 计算机网络基础 - Http协议【 http方法 + http缓存 】

http 方法 常见的 http 方法 1、GET: 获取资源 2、POST: 传输实体主体 3、PUT: 传输文件 4、HEAD: 获取报文首部 5、DELETE: 删除文件 6、OPTIONS: 查询支持方法 7、TRACK: 追踪路径 8、CONNECT: 要求用隧道协议连接代理 GET 与 ......
网络基础 http 缓存 计算机 基础

js树形控件—zTree使用

https://blog.csdn.net/qq_35934094/article/details/80852989 https://www.cnblogs.com/leechenxiang/p/5952959.html https://www.jianshu.com/p/99d24aab74a5 ......
树形 控件 zTree

读取Oracle的long字段存放大文本导致流关闭、系统异常的解决方法

1.首先在oracle中的replace function窗口中添加方法 CREATE OR REPLACE FUNCTION LONG_TO_CHAR(IN_WHERE VARCHAR, IN_TABLE_NAME VARCHAR, IN_COLUMN VARCHAR2) RETURN VARCH ......
字段 文本 方法 Oracle 系统

使用npm安装nrm的问题

安装环境 电脑环境:windows node版本:16.9.1 npm版本:8.19.3 问题 安装nrm成功使用命令后出现以下报错 npm i nrm -g nrm ls 解决方案: 删除当前的nrm npm uninstall nrm -g 安装如下代码 npm install Pana/nrm ......
问题 npm nrm

台达AS系列PLC modbus TCP网口上位机通信,项目现场使用设备的C#源代码

台达AS系列PLC modbus TCP网口上位机通信,项目现场使用设备的C#源代码,监控设备每月每天的生产数据并生成Excel表格。YID:539639974409011 ......
网口 源代码 项目 modbus 设备

MySQL 数据分组后取第一条数据

-- 不加 distinct(a.id) order by 会有问题 导致获取出来的数据不对 SELECT id,title,description,poster_id,poster_time,drug_id FROM ( SELECT DISTINCT(a.id) tid, a.* FROM cm ......
数据 MySQL

TS+Vue3+Echarts的封装与使用

TS+Vue3+Echarts的组件封装步骤如下 统计分析页面使用栅格布局进行规划 抽离组件 分别包括数字面板组件count-card,统计面板组件chart-card及特定图表组件(如:pie-echart, map-echart等) 在统计分析页面通过store获取数据 strore通过acti ......
Echarts Vue3 Vue TS